What should motorcyclists do to anticipate potential hazards when managing road conditions?
Keeping an eye well down the road and scanning for changes is a proactive approach to anticipate potential hazards, such as sudden stops, entering vehicles, or changes in road conditions. This vigilance allows motorcyclists to prepare in advance, adjust speed or position, and handle situations more safely and effectively.
